The palace of Rong Si is not far from Li Qingmu’s place, so he didn’t take a carriage, but walked slowly.

The air outside is somewhat better than inside the palace, at least not as oppressive.

Behind him, four maids followed closely, each with their heads lowered, looking very docile.

Li Qingmu walked with his hands behind his back, appearing calm, but his heart was cold.

That kind of coldness is like a bone-deep sore that lingers.

He really couldn’t understand why a mother could be so cruel to her own flesh and blood.

She drugged him, erased all his memories, and then trapped him in a gilded cage, letting so-called teachers tell him about his life experiences over the years, weaving a false life.

The absurd thing is, he has to accept all of this!

Deprived of freedom, monitored daily like a prisoner, every move reported to her, even drinking water, eating, and using the toilet, without exception!

If this continues, he’ll go insane!

Yet, he has no choice but to endure, even suppressing too much negative emotion, lest they think the memory wipe is incomplete and might poison him!

She’s capable of such acts, so the so-called poisoning is only a matter of time!

At present, he must think of a way to escape this situation, but how can he possibly manage it?

Here he has no power, no acquaintances, all are Rong Si’s people, what should he do?

This is a deadlock, a deadlock that, no matter how clever he is, he can’t break!

The large sleeves hid his hands, concealing his tightly clenched fists!

"Young master, the palace of the Princess has arrived."

Li Qingmu was so absorbed in thought that, despite arriving at the destination, he hadn’t gone inside, prompting a maid behind him to remind him.

Li Qingmu hesitated for a moment and asked, "Mother shouldn’t have gone to bed yet, right?"

"Young master’s filial piety is commendable, Her Highness doesn’t retire until the Hai hour each night."

"Why sleep so late? It’s not healthy for the body!"

"Young master might not know, the Emperor is young and cannot handle many matters, all relying on Her Highness to help, Her Highness has endless affairs every day!"

Ha, what help, this is clearly controlling all the power!

Li Qingmu’s heart mocked, but his face remained respectful, "Then I’ll go see Mother!"

"Please, young master!"

"Mu’er, why the sudden thought to see Mother?"

Rong Si had just finished handling some memorials and, seeing Li Qingmu enter, rose with a smile.

This son has been very obedient for more than two months, cooperating with their "memory recovery," truly worry-free, so Rong Si’s smile widened upon seeing him.

Li Qingmu said, "Child was bored in the room, so I came out for a walk and unconsciously came to Mother, seems like I’m constantly thinking of seeing Mother!"

Uh...

The maids couldn’t help but criticize, young master’s flattery is really slick, wasn’t he just saying he came specifically before, now he turns and makes it seem accidental, doesn’t this further emphasize the deep bond?

Of course, it’s a good thing, showing the brainwashing of late has been successful, the maids exchanged glances in celebration.

Rong Si looked comfortedly at her obedient son and waved her hand, prompting the maids behind Li Qingmu to leave immediately.

"Mu’er, speak, what brings you to Mother?"

Li Qingmu’s words were merely pleasantries, concerning the supposed deep mother-son relationship Rong Si did not believe much, as despite memory loss, some things won’t change.

This child must have come for a reason.

Li Qingmu thought for a moment, knowing his mother wasn’t easily fooled, and said, "Mother, just now Princess Nianxi came over, saying after autumn we’ll be married, is that true?"

Rong Si said, "Originally, mother wanted to tell you about this matter, but considering you’ve just recovered from a severe illness and forget so many things, I thought to wait and mention it later, but now that she’s told you, it is indeed the case!"

Li Qingmu lowered his eyes, silent.

Rong Si noticed his unwillingness and frowned slightly, "What’s wrong, my son finds something amiss?"

"Mother, child has no feelings for this Princess Nianxi, but as a member of the Imperial Family, I know marital affairs cannot be decided by personal preference, so can child please ask Mother to allow more interaction with her? As for the marriage, could it be postponed?"

Rong Si looked at her son, seeing his sincere gaze, seemingly genuine, sighed, "Princess Nianxi is deeply in love with you, but alas, unrequited love. Wanting more interaction is good, as for the marriage, that’s another matter!"

Another matter?

Li Qingmu felt slightly anxious inside but remained respectfully responsive: "Yes, child understands."

Rong Si relented, allowing for some leeway.

Li Qingmu contemplated how to further gain her trust, noticing her rubbing her brow, slightly leaning back, clearly tired from reading many memorials.

Li Qingmu slightly shifted his gaze, then approached, "Mother, are you tired? Shall you rest a bit, child can massage your shoulders?"

When previously with Long Yue, since she often did needlework, her eyes and neck would ache, so Li Qingmu would massage her.

Truth be told, Li Qingmu’s strength control was excellent, Long Yue always said it felt incredibly comfortable.

Rong Si looked at her gentle and tender son with surprise and nodded slightly, "Alright, Mother is indeed a bit tired."

She said this and moved to the edge of the bed to lie down softly, while Li Qingmu circled behind her to massage her shoulders.

"You little fellow, are quite skilled, this strength is neither too heavy nor too light, really comfortable. Oh, those Imperial Physicians can massage, but because of gender norms, they change to a woman instead, and the strength is always lacking, only my son measures up."

"Mother, we have a bond, others wouldn’t match up as child does."

This compliment was pleasing to Rong Si, she closed her eyes, relishing in this rare warmth.

Nearby, only four maids were present, bowing slightly, very well-behaved.

Li Qingmu knew none of these people were simple, so he refrained from acting rashly.

Currently, he’s too isolated, the only opening being Rong Si.

Rong Si controlled all power, the young emperor was merely a puppet; she was the real Empress of Daliang Country. To escape his predicament, Li Qingmu must first placate this Empress.

Thankfully she’s Li Qingmu’s biological mother, otherwise, this annoying act of pretending to be obedient and flattering would make him want to slam his head against tofu out of frustration.

After rubbing for nearly half an hour, his hand was slightly sore when sudden hurried footsteps echoed from outside.

Li Qingmu promptly stopped, while Rong Si, in a drowsy state, was awakened.

"What happened?" she frowned and asked.

A maid rushed in, knelt, and said, "Reporting to Princess, two spies from the enemy country were caught outside!"
